QSAN XN5 Series — Performance-Oriented All-NVMe Unified Storage
Enterprise unified, NVMe across the bus.
The QSAN XN5 series is the flagship of the new dual-active NVMe unified line. Same 26-bay chassis platform as the [XF5 series](/vendors/qsan/products/xf5-series) block array, but configured for higher sustained IOPS and the lowest latency QSM 4 can deliver. For Australian enterprises running mission-critical workloads — virtualisation at scale, database hosting, low-latency file collaboration — the XN5226 is the unified-protocol option that doesn't force a separate SAN-plus-NAS purchase.
QSM 4 brings the full enterprise data-services suite to the array: WORM compliance, SED encryption at folder/pool/drive level, XMirror replication across geographies, public-cloud tier-out, snapshot and replication policies, deduplication and compression. The shared platform with XF5 means partners get an upper bound on performance from the XF5's published figures — 50,000 random-write IOPS at 100µs latency (100,000 at 200µs) on PCIe Gen4. Mirrored firmware HA delivers 99.9999%+ availability through controller events.

Controllers
Dual active-active controllers (HA) with mirrored firmware
Drive Bays
26-bay NVMe (2.5" U.2 NVMe SSDs) in 2U
Protocols
iSCSI block + CIFS / NFS / AFP / FTP / WebDAV file
Operating System
QSM 4 — 128-bit ZFS-based unified management with cross-platform replication
Availability
99.9999%+ uptime via mirrored firmware design
Performance Reference
Shared platform with XF5 (50,000 random-write IOPS @ 100µs, PCIe Gen4 NVMe upper bound)
Data Services
WORM, SED, XMirror geo-replication, deduplication, compression, snapshots
Hardware Platform
Shared chassis with XF5 series and KS2 (qs_hm_XF52-XN52, qs_hm_KS22-XN52)
The XN5 competes directly against NetApp AFF C-series and Dell PowerStore 1000T+. Pure FlashArray//C is a near match on raw performance but Pure won't sell unified — they'd push FlashBlade for file. QSAN's true active-active dual controllers plus ZFS data integrity give a credible technical story; pricing typically lands 30–50% below NetApp AFF for similar raw IOPS. QSM 4's cross-platform replication into XEVO 3 block arrays remains the structural differentiator that NetApp, Dell, and Pure don't offer between their own product lines.
